The New York Jets faced off against the San Francisco 49ers on September 9, 2024, in what was a highly anticipated game, especially with Aaron Rodgers making his return for the Jets after a significant injury. Here's how the game unfolded:

- **Final Score**: The 49ers won convincingly with a score of 32-19 against the Jets.

- **Game Highlights**:
- **49ers' Offense**: Despite missing key players like Christian McCaffrey, the 49ers' offense was led by Jordan Mason, who had a breakout game, rushing for 147 yards and a touchdown. The 49ers' strategy leaned heavily on their ground game, which was effective in controlling the clock and the game's pace. They also utilized Deebo Samuel effectively, who scored on a 2-yard run. Jake Moody contributed significantly with six field goals, tying a franchise record.

- **Jets' Offense**: Aaron Rodgers showed flashes of his former self, throwing for 167 yards with one touchdown and one interception. His return was marked by moments of brilliance, including a 36-yard touchdown pass to Allen Lazard. However, the Jets struggled with ball control and turnovers, which hampered their momentum. The offensive line's performance was mixed, providing Rodgers with time on some plays but failing in others, particularly in the run game.

- **Defensive Struggles**: The Jets' defense, which was expected to be a strength, struggled against the 49ers' rushing attack. They couldn't generate consistent pressure on the quarterback, which allowed the 49ers to control the game through long, sustained drives. The secondary performed better against the pass, but missed tackles and poor gap discipline in the run defense were notable weaknesses.

- **Key Moments**:
- The game started with the Jets showing promise, but an early fumble by Breece Hall set a tone of struggle for the Jets' offense.
- Rodgers' interception in the second half, following a promising drive, was a turning point, leading to further points for the 49ers.
- The 49ers' ability to score on each of their final eight possessions highlighted their dominance, particularly in time of possession and rushing yards.

- **Post-Game Sentiment**: The loss was a wake-up call for the Jets, indicating areas like run defense and offensive line play needing immediate attention. For the 49ers, the game reinforced their status as contenders, showcasing depth in their roster with players stepping up in the absence of key contributors.

This game not only marked Rodgers' return but also highlighted the 49ers' resilience and depth, setting the tone for what could be an interesting season for both teams.
